[QUOTE="Teemore, post: 640922, member: 1375"] If you just want to detect beaches then a good entry level is the xTerra ... a few coils around to enhance them (should be able to find some 2nd hand). Currently the higher end Equinox series seem to be in favour, they can also be used in your search for gold. Most VLF have some form of discrimination to help any decision to dig although it's always best to check regardless. The older CTX (3030) also seemed to be in favour, again may be able to find a 2nd hand unit. Best option of course is to ge for the latest ML offering, the 6000 is just as good on beaches as it is on gold BUT comes with a hefty price tag. [/QUOTE]
